The year 2021 was full of big game shows and live streams. E3, gamescom, showcases of great developers … but not all of them really had a lot of great calibers with them. That should look different with the Game Awards 2021, because presenter Geoff Keighley is already heating up the rumor mill. It was previously said that we would be shown 40 to 50 games at the event – and four or five of them should be the caliber of an Elden Ring.

Big announcements are on the way

Show host Geoff Keighley recently spoke about Elden Ring’s presentation at Summer Game Fest, which in June was undoubtedly the highlight of the evening. In this context, he insisted on fueling the hype for the Game Awards.

At the Game Awards there are probably four or five things at this level. I can’t wait to show this to people.

Although this claim is of course quite vague at first, it also continues to fuel fan hopes. There are numerous rumors circulating about reveals The Last of Us, Breath of the Wild 2 or Starfield and Elder Scrolls 6.
